  • Patent number: 8970527
    Abstract: A low power driving and sensing system for capacitive touch panels includes a capacitive touch panel, a first switch device, a second switch device, a driving device, a sensing device, and a control device. The capacitive touch panel has plural first conductor lines arranged in a first direction and plural second conductor lines arranged in a second direction. The driving device is connected to the first switch device for driving the capacitive touch panel. The sensing device is connected to the second switch device for sensing the capacitive touch panel. The control device configures the first switch device and the second switch device for entering the capacitive touch panel into a self-capacitance mode such that the driving device and the sensing device perform a self capacitance sensing, and into a mutual capacitance mode such that the driving device and the sensing device perform a mutual capacitance sensing.

  • Publication number: 20140132560
    Abstract: An in-cell multi-touch display panel system includes a multi-touch LCD display panel and a touch display control subsystem. The multi-touch LCD display panel has a TFT layer, a detection electrode layer, and a common-voltage and touch-driving layer. The detection electrode layer has M first conductor lines for performing touch detection by sampling touch detection from the M first conductor lines. The common-voltage and touch-driving layer has N second conductor lines for receiving common voltage in display and touch-driving signal in touch detection. In the detection electrode layer, there are pluralities of detection electrode areas in the intersections of first conductor lines and second conductor lines. Each detection electrode area is connected to a first conductor line by a touch-control transistor. The M×N touch-control transistors are divided in to N sets corresponding to N second conductor lines respectively.

  • Publication number: 20130285952
    Abstract: An in-cell multi-touch display panel system includes a touch LCD panel and a touch display control subsystem. The touch LCD panel has a TFT layer, a conductive electrode layer, and a common-voltage and touch-driving layer. The TFT layer has K gate driving lines and L source driving lines for a display operation. The conductive electrode layer has M first conduct lines for a touch detection operation by sampling a touch detection result from the M first conduct lines. The common-voltage and touch-driving layer has N second conduct lines for receiving a common voltage signal in display and receiving a touch-driving signal in touch detection. The K gate driving lines are divided into N groups respectively corresponding to the N second conduct line. When one group of gate driving lines has the display driving signal, the corresponding second conduct line is connected to the common voltage signal.

  • Publication number: 20130234981
    Abstract: A control system for a capacitive touch screen is provided. The control system comprises a touch detecting circuit, touch hard instruction, a storage module and a controller. The touch detecting circuit detects a capacitance variance to generate touch data. The touch hard instruction executes a touch computing function on the touch data. The storage module is connected to the touch detecting circuit and the at least one touch hard instruction, and records the touch data generated by the touch detecting circuit and the touch data computed by the touch hard instruction. The controller is connected to the touch detecting circuit, the at least one touch hard instruction, and the storage module, and assigns at least one touch task of a touch algorithm to the at least one touch hard instruction, so as to execute a corresponding touch computing function of the touch algorithm.

  • Publication number: 20120169070
    Abstract: A solenoid-operated electric lock includes a lock casing, a catch movably mounted on the lock casing, and a solenoid received in the lock casing. The solenoid includes a housing, a first magnet and a second magnet respectively mounted on two ends of the housing, and a movable iron core disposed in the housing. A first bolt is disposed on the movable iron core. A wire coil is wound around the movable iron core. The locking casing receives a driving member, a first gearing device, and a second gearing device. The driving member is selectively pressed by the first bolt. The first gearing device is engaged with the driving member and has a rotatable cylinder mounted therein. The second gearing device has a lever selectively abutting against the catch. The lever has an abutting portion formed thereon for releasably connecting with an outer periphery of the rotatable cylinder.

  • Patent number: 7770947
    Abstract: An electromagnetic lock comprises: a body combined with a retaining frame by using locking studs and retaining screws; one side of the retaining frame being installed with a trigger receiving box; and an absorption plate combined to a supporting frame; two metal rings being installed in the absorption plate; the absorption plate having locking screws; wherein in installation, for aligning the body and the absorption plate, adjusting screws are installed between the absorption plate and the supporting frame. The supporting frame has screw holes for receiving the adjusting screws; one side of the supporting frame has two magnetic holes for receiving magnets; a magnet protection sheet are installed at lower side of the magnets; and a small screw serves to lock the protection sheet to the supporting frame. The trigger can be hidden so as to occupy a small space and the installation work is easy.

  • Publication number: 20100116006
    Abstract: A strike lock includes an upper frame, a lower frame, a door position detector, a door position detecting spring, an electromagnetic tube, a detecting switch assembly, a buckle assembly, a press assembly, and a lock assembly. The detecting switching assembly is formed by a door position detecting switch, a substrate, and an electromagnetic tube detecting switch. The buckle assembly is formed by a buckle, a buckling spring, and a straight screw. The press assembly is formed by a positioning plate, a press unit, a pressing spring, and a positioning screw. The lock assembly is formed by a lock, a support unit, and a locking spring. The operation of the strike lock is that the electromagnetic tube moves transversally to push the buckle assembly, when the press assembly can move downwards to buckle the buckle assembly, the locking spring and the lock are free to move to have the object of door unlocking.

  • Patent number: 7237412
    Abstract: A magnetic lock comprises an actuation portion; a positioning seat having a slot at a rear end thereof for receiving the actuation portion and a circuit board; a tongue embedded at the slot at the lower end of the positioning seat and being fixed to the connecting sheet; the tongue being movable within the positioning seat; a retaining seat having a displace unit; a core embedded into the slot of the retaining seat and to combine with the displace unit; thereby the movable post, driving sheet, connecting sheet and tongue being interconnected. The magnetic lock is suitable for doors of various specifications. Furthermore, the magnetic lock has an open mode in power-on state and a close-mode in power-off state. Moreover, a pin serves to achieve the object of function setting modes. The magnetic lock has the functions of a mechanical lock and an electronic lock.

  • Patent number: 7014226
    Abstract: An electromagnetic lock device includes a receptacle, a deadbolt slidably engaged in the receptacle and extendible out of the receptacle, for locking a door panel to a door frame, a shaft attached to one end of the deadbolt. A housing is attached to the receptacle, and includes a plunger core slidably received in a coil and actuatable by the coil and having a pin. An elbow includes an arm pivotally secured to the receptacle, an opening formed in an intermediate connecting portion to slidably receive the pin, and another arm having an oblong hole to slidably receive the shaft, and to allow the deadbolt to be forced in and out of the receptacle by the plunger core via the elbow. A spring member may bias the plunger core out of the housing, when the coil is not energized.
